    Fishing near Houston / Kingwood

    My 6 year old nephew wants to go fishing so I’m looking for recommendations on places near Houston or Kingwood. I assume lake Houston is my best bet, but I only fish saltwater and solo out of my kayak, so I’m seeking the wisdom of the green screen. I’d appreciate any advice on best spots to bank fish and any other tips. Doesn’t matter what species, just want him to catch a fish.

        There are some fishing spots there but not sure how it is this time of year. Springtime you can tear up the white bass. With a six year old your gonna want quick and easy. Just to the right of where you get to the creek is a pretty big hole. Some worms might get you some perch or little catfish. Hope yall have fun and catch some!
